packaging is what makes me buy a cd/lp/cassette instead of downloading it. to me, it's very important, but i'd never buy music based on packaging alone. i've seen so many bad albums come in neat packages, it's insane.

my favorite packaging would have to be boris' "soundtrack for film: mabuta no ura" (the brazilian box version). it came in a hand sculpted wooden box, filled with dead flower petals, a bunch of really nice album art cards, the cd itself, and string to tie it all together. it was limited to 199 copies and was worth every penny.
